This projector offers a DICOM Simulation Mode 2 to simulate the results of devices compliant with the Digital Imaging and Communications in Medicine (DICOM) Part 14 standardized display function for display of grayscale images. The DICOM Simulation Mode 2 adjusts the gradation between the minimum and the maximum luminance so gradation is distributed optimally. This feature is optimized for displaying medical images such as X-rays, CAT scans and MRIs, which makes this projector ideal for non-diagnostic purposes such as lectures, academic meetings and in-hospital conferences. This feature is recommended for use in medical schools for training and educational use only.
To optimize color and detail for medical imaging, this projector supports both Blue Base and Clear Base color temperature settings. This feature allows adjustment to achieve the same colors used for DICOM SIM standards, and gives educators the opportunity to adjust color tone according to the type of medical image being shown. In addition to these two settings, presenters have the ability to alter the color temperature between 3 user defined color temperatures for a total of five presets.
Presentations can be enhanced with Picture by Picture split-screen functionality, allowing viewers to see two images side by side from two different viewing sources simultaneously. An advantage of the Picture by Picture Mode is that it also allows both DICOM Simulation images and sRGB Modes to be shown together, meaning a CAT scan, for example, can be simultaneously viewed alongside a live surgery video to bring training to life.

The exceptional imaging performance of this projector starts with Canon's proprietary AISYS (Aspectual Illumination System) Optical Engine, which utilizes advanced light management technology to maximize the contrast and brightness benefits of the projector's LCOS (Liquid Crystal on Silicon) display panels, which deliver superior reflectivity and durability while accomplishing high luminance. The result is highly detailed, seamless, ultra-sharp image projection in virtually any environment.
Drawing on Canon's advanced optical expertise, this projector utilizes Genuine Canon Optics to project high-quality, virtually distortion-free images.
The lens features a multitude of Canon Lens technologies, such as dual-sided aspherical lens elements as well as Ultra Low Dispersion (UD) lens elements. These elements significantly reduce chromatic aberration, curvilinear distortion, ghosting and flare to create sharp and clear images in a compact projector size.
A short throw ratio of 0.56:1 means that a 100-inch diagonal image can be projected from an approximate distance of only 4 feet away, with virtually no image distortion. This allows for large, accurate images in tight spaces from museums and galleries to simulation and training.
A large vertical (0–75%) and horizontal (±10%) lens shift allows for adjustment of the image with virtually no distortion. Users can be virtually assured that this projector can be optimally positioned to suit their specific environment and needs.
Combined, the short throw ratio and significant lens shift help produce an optimized viewing angle that achieves virtually no distortion right up to the very edge of the image. A deep depth of focus (F2.7) allows images to be rendered highly accurately onto a variety of curved surfaces. Where other projectors may distort or bow at the edges, Canon's optical technology keeps the image periphery extremely straight – exhibiting significantly low TV distortion. This results in beautiful images with smooth edges.

This projector is equipped with a built-in HDBaseT™ receiver facilitating uncompressed HD video, audio and control signals to be transmitted over one single LAN cable with a maximum distance of 100m. This reduces complex wiring schemes used for a typical setup as well as maximizing long cable runs with minimal image quality degradation.
A variety of advanced installation settings provide added customization options for challenging installation areas.
The Edge Blending function enables the user to combine multiple images to create a seamless, extra-wide projection. Advanced functions allow for color blending and black level adjustments to maximize image quality.
The Registration function modifies the registration by electronically correcting color shift due to changes in alignment of each RGB panel position.
The Micro-Digital Image Shift function shifts the image electrically, using the surplus pixels on the LCOS panel.
